TOLL OF SPEED.

WEEK-END FATALITIES. SYDNEY, February 27. Another fatal accident occurred on the Maroubra speedway yesterday. A machine ridden by J. Donaghy skidded, and the rider was thrown with terrific force. He sustained grave injuries to -the head and died in hospital. A message from Melbourne says a motor car was smashed through colliding with a standard on the railway line at Brighton. One of the passengers, Mr. Eric Dunk, and a girl named Jessie Ferguson, were killed. Four other persons were injured.
